Key Features to Look For

Protein Source
  • Whey Protein: This is a popular choice. It comes from milk and our bodies digest it quickly. It’s great after a workout.
  • Casein Protein: Also from milk, casein digests slowly. It’s good for keeping you full longer, like before bed.
  • Plant-Based Proteins: These are made from plants like peas, rice, hemp, or soy. They are great for vegetarians, vegans, or those with dairy allergies.
  • Blends: Some shakes mix different protein types for a balanced effect.
Sweeteners
  • Look for shakes sweetened with natural options like stevia, monk fruit, or erythritol.
  • Avoid shakes with lots of added sugar or artificial sweeteners if you’re watching your sugar intake.
Other Ingredients
  • Vitamins and Minerals: Some shakes add extra nutrients to give you a bigger health boost.
  • Fiber: Fiber helps with digestion and makes you feel full.
  • Healthy Fats: Ingredients like MCT oil or flaxseed can add beneficial fats.
  • Digestive Enzymes: These can help your body break down the protein better, especially if you have a sensitive stomach.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Protein Shakes at Whole Foods

Q: What is the main benefit of drinking protein shakes?

A: Protein shakes help you get more protein into your diet. This is important for building and repairing muscles, and it can help you feel full.

Q: Are protein shakes at Whole Foods healthy?

A: Many protein shakes at Whole Foods are healthy because they use good ingredients. Always check the label to be sure.

Q: What’s the difference between whey and plant-based protein?

A: Whey protein comes from milk. Plant-based protein comes from plants like peas or rice. Whey digests faster, while plant-based is good for people who don’t eat dairy.

Q: Can I drink a protein shake instead of a meal?

A: Yes, some protein shakes can be a meal replacement if they have other nutrients like carbs and fats. Look for ones that are more complete.

Q: How much protein should I look for in a shake?

A: A good amount to aim for is usually between 20 to 30 grams of protein per serving.
